Just want to find out if you guys think this is a good deal!
I need to find out if this is a good deal. I'm new to the sport, was always interested in electric, so advice is muchly appreciated. Thank you so much!
Ok so he says 175 Canadian, and that is definitely my price range, here is what he sent me...
The most popular 1/10 4 wheel drive 2 speed off-road buggy in the world just got better! At each evolutionary step, the Xtreme has been improved upon to keep it at the peak of the RC off-road buggy field. So how do you make an Xtreme better? Extra speed, extra adjustability, extra toughness! The new Xtreme is packed with features that have been suggested by Xtreme owners: More room for the electronics, easier access to the differentials and transmission, and more suspension adjustability. The result is the best Xtreme ever.
The heart of the Xtreme truck line has always been a .18 engine with reliable and consistent power for tough off-road driving. With revised porting and crankshaft, internal airflow has been optimized for increased power and torque.
RTR 100% factory assembled with installed engine and radio gear makes getting started easy
The 2.5mm lightweight aluminum alloy chassis provides excellent performance and durability
New lightweight suspension arms deliver quick suspension response and reduce the critical sprung weight and overall weight of the car
Oil filled shocks with firm tuned springs keep the wheels on the ground
The new .18 engine features a new crankcase and upgrades to the cylinder, piston, connecting rod and crankshaft, delivers more power, more torque and extra cooling.
2-Speed transmission for fast acceleration and insane top end speed
High capacity fuel tank with perfect caliber makes it impossible to overflow and provides long run times
So what you guys think?

what a load of BS......."most popular buggy" um no..........
thats just either a REDCAT or SMARTECH with a diffrent name they are all over ebay........chinesse nocks off, ive broken in a few at the LHS i work at and honestly a truly a pain in the butt......and to find parts for that car GOOD LUCK!!!! under 200 bucks there isnt much RC u could buy........
but for about 260 bucks u could buy a HPI FIRESTORM and have a great car, and part readily avaible anywhere

Avoid that buggy like the black death. Its an "ebay special" style buggy. One of those designs that just sorta floats around and gets branded by everyone. That radio system is junk, I've used it.
Get a buggy by a reputable manufacturer.

I will agree with the above posts and strongly suggest that you stay away from this company, I looked at there web site and it looks like all of there stuff is just a cheap copy of better know company's. With this kinda thing I doubt you would get any customer support and you will probably have a hard time finding parts, and if it comes to that think about a $175 dollar paper weight because you can't get parts.
